
In the very first episode of 2019, I sat down to chat with serial entrepreneur, Sevetri Wilson.
Sevetri is the founder and CEO of Solid Ground Innovations, a strategic communications firm, which she started in 2009 and grew to a 7-figure company. As the ever-evolving businesswoman, she did not stop there. She later went on to start her second company, Resilia (formerly ExemptMeNow), a tech start-up in 2016 and has made history as the first Black female tech entrepreneur in New Orleans to raise over $2 million in capital for her start-up.
We take a deep dive into her journey in this episode and she shares a ton of advice she’s received along the way.
